It seems that 'taupe' seems to be a popular colour at the moment but there are so many different variations of what it is. There seems to be grey, purple, brown or pink ones and to be honest, I would say she sits somewhere between the purple and pink 'taupey land'. 




The formula was nice, it seems a little thin on the first coat but levels up and is more opaque with the second, but I still needed a third for a better finish. What I didn't like about this was the brush, with a weird shape and being quite hard, its difficult to control where the polish is going. I also found that I got allot of drag when applying the second coat which was quite annoying which is another reason why I ended up going for three coats to give me the beauty you see here. But even with the three coats she still dried nice and quickly, this is great if you are waiting to stamp.

I have mixed feelings about her, but overall I think she's a nice addition to my collection. When I have other polishes that are more opaque and easier to work with I fear she may get pushed aside a little, but you might see her again in the future.
